Waterstones is a specialist bookseller with a strong presence in the UK book-buying landscape, serving readers who want access to new releases, established titles, gifts, stationery, and reading-related products in one place. Its appeal comes from the combination of a broad online catalogue and physical bookshops where customers can browse recommendations, compare editions, and discover authors beyond the most visible bestsellers. For shoppers, the store is especially useful when the purchase requires more thought than a simple product search, such as choosing a gift, building a reading list, or finding a particular edition.
Shopping at Waterstones: range, value, and practical savings
The catalogue covers major fiction and nonfiction categories, children’s books, young adult titles, academic and study materials, graphic novels, poetry, cookery, travel, history, and lifestyle subjects. Customers can also find notebooks, journals, games, literary gifts, and selected accessories. This mixture makes the retailer relevant to both regular readers and occasional shoppers looking for a present with a clear personal connection.
One of the store’s most useful features is the way its range supports different buying intentions. A reader searching for a newly published novel can usually browse by genre or author, while someone buying for another person can explore themed gift selections and popular recommendations. The physical shops add another layer of convenience: staff suggestions, display tables, and curated sections can make discovery easier than relying only on search filters.
How coupons and promotions usually work
Book discounts tend to appear in several forms rather than through one permanent offer. Shoppers may encounter selected-title promotions, seasonal campaigns, multibuy opportunities, clearance pricing, or reduced prices on particular formats. These offers can be more valuable when applied to books already on a planned reading list, because the saving is then tied to a purchase the customer intended to make rather than an impulse buy.
Coupon listings should be checked carefully before applying them. The key details are the eligible products, minimum spend, delivery conditions, and whether the promotion applies online, in shops, or across both channels. Some offers may exclude newly released books, special editions, gift items, or already reduced products. A coupon that looks attractive at first glance may provide little practical value if the basket contains titles outside its terms.
For the best result, compare the final basket total with the ordinary price of each item before completing checkout. A promotion can be worthwhile even when it does not apply to every product, particularly if it reduces the cost of several eligible books. It is also sensible to review whether a delivery charge changes the overall saving, since a small discount may be offset when the order is below the relevant shipping threshold.

Online ordering and shop visits
The online experience is most helpful for locating specific editions, checking availability, and browsing a wider selection than may fit on a local shop’s shelves. Edition details matter in book shopping: cover design, binding, publication format, translation, and supplementary content can all differ. Reading the product description carefully reduces the risk of ordering an edition that is unsuitable for a gift or collection.
Physical branches remain valuable for customers who prefer immediate browsing or want advice before buying. They are also convenient for last-minute gifts when a title is needed without waiting for delivery. In-store stock can vary, so checking availability before travelling is a sensible step when the purchase is time-sensitive. For collectible, signed, or special-format books, customers should pay close attention to the exact product description and condition information.
Delivery considerations are important for online orders. Customers should select an address where parcels can be received securely and allow extra time when ordering gifts, study materials, or books needed for travel. During busy seasonal periods, popular releases and promotional items may experience stronger demand. Ordering earlier reduces the pressure to choose a more expensive delivery option.

How can I use a Waterstones coupon code?
To redeem a Waterstones coupon, add eligible books or other products to your basket and continue to checkout. Enter the code in the promotional-code field before paying, then select the option to apply it. Check that the discount appears in the order summary. Some offers apply only to selected titles, require a minimum spend, or cannot be combined with another promotion.
Are Waterstones coupons genuine, and how can I check whether one is valid?
Coupons listed on reputable voucher websites should include clear terms, an expiry date, and details of the products or services covered. At Waterstones checkout, a valid code normally applies immediately and updates the basket total. If it fails, check spelling, eligibility, minimum-spend requirements, and whether the offer is limited to new customers or a particular country. Never pay a fee to obtain a coupon.
Do Waterstones discount codes have expiration dates or restrictions?
Yes, most Waterstones promotional codes are available for a limited period and may stop working after the stated expiry date or once a promotional allocation has ended. Restrictions can include selected books, exclusions for gift cards, pre-orders, delivery charges, or marketplace items. Read the offer conditions carefully, because codes may also be limited to one use per customer and may not be combined.
What delivery options and shipping policies does Waterstones offer?
Waterstones generally offers home delivery and, where available, collection from participating stores. Delivery charges, estimated arrival times, and eligibility can vary according to the item, destination, stock location, and order value. A coupon may reduce the product price without covering postage. Before completing payment, review the delivery estimate and final shipping charge shown in your basket, especially for international orders.
Can I return an item bought with a Waterstones coupon?
Returns are usually subject to Waterstones’ current returns policy, including time limits, product condition, and exclusions for items such as personalized products, certain digital purchases, or opened media. If an order purchased with a coupon is refunded, the discount may not be reusable and the refund may reflect the reduced price paid. Keep your receipt or order confirmation and follow the instructions provided by Waterstones.
